Transaction 299712a455b5e7604000496e948d1343f9198e809928cb346952081168c57926

1 Input
2 Outputs
  • 299712a455b5e7604000496e948d1343f9198e809928cb346952081168c57926:0
  • value  35417329
    address  3EVhvCejQDYNcJmtWNTFw9siEJogGkjjtB
  • 299712a455b5e7604000496e948d1343f9198e809928cb346952081168c57926:1
  • value  76306106
    address  3Kzo2vQVi351DWczZieAiVeJG2sgBRkBPQ